Corrective breast surgery

Corrective breast surgery, sometimes called breast revision surgery, is designed to improve the results of a previous breast operation that may not have achieved the outcome you desired. This may be due to changes over time, complications such as implant malposition or capsular contracture, or simply because your goals and preferences have evolved.
